The Three Bars
Milk Chocolate

The plain one, and that is the argument for it. Creamy milk chocolate, scored into 10 squares, with no mix-ins and no flavor concept on top. If you want to know what a Day Tripper bar tastes like without anything else in the way, start here.
Cookies and Cream

White chocolate base with cookie crumble throughout it. The sweetest of the three and the most familiar, which makes it the safe pick if you are buying for someone who has not tried one of these before.
Crunch

Milk chocolate with crispy rice worked through it. The texture is the whole difference here. Crisped rice breaks up what would otherwise be a dense mouthful and keeps a square from coating the way solid chocolate can.
How to Choose
With three bars this close together, it comes down to two questions.
Do you want texture? If yes, Crunch. If you would rather the chocolate be smooth all the way through, Milk Chocolate.
How sweet do you want it? Cookies and Cream is the sweetest by a clear margin, since white chocolate contains more sugar than milk chocolate. Milk Chocolate sits in the middle. There is no dark option in this line, so if you reach for dark chocolate everywhere else, you would be looking at a different brand.

Storage
Cool, dry, away from direct heat and sunlight. Keep the bar sealed between uses. Break squares at room temperature, since a warm bar bends instead of snapping and a cold one shatters unevenly. Keep out of reach of children and pets.
